Last Friday, Torshamnen (Gothenberg, Sweden) woke up to see the history being created when BSM managed Gas Supply Vessel, Kairos, delivered 1035 m3 LNG to Eagle Balder, a 125,000 DWT Aframax shuttle – the first ship-to-ship LNG operations at Tornshamnen. Eagle Balder did not have to suspend her cargo operations, thanks to a careful Risk Assessment conducted by the BSM team to ensure Simultaneous Operations were performed to the industry’s best practices.
Christoffer Lillhage, Port of Gothenburg Operations Manager, mentioned: “This is yet another milestone for the Port of Gothenburg in our ambition to increase the use of alternative shipping fuels for a more sustainable future”.
